Earth Month Challenge: Ditch the Grass & Save Water!
April is Earth Month, and one of the best ways to protect Colorado’s water is by replacing thirsty lawns with drought-friendly landscapes! Swapping out grass for water-wise plants saves up to 60% water, reduces maintenance, and creates a beautiful, pollinator-friendly yard. Longmont’s Lawn Replacement Program makes it easy to make the switch—with rebates available! Pair your lawn replacement with a Garden In A Box for an effortless, stunning transformation. Tree Branch Collection
The City of Longmont offers a FREE curbside collection of tree branches each spring. Branches must be placed curbside before 7 am on the Monday of your scheduled collection week and remain at the curb until picked up. Citywide branch collection runs April 14-18 for areas south of 9th Avenue. For more information call 303-651-8416 or visit bit.ly/springcurbside.
